The deposit of assets will have to come about no later than the 60th working day after receipt from the distribution. Any amount that isn't deposited within that time period will be subject to income tax (as well as the 10% distribution penalty tax if less than age fifty nine ½).

Some use the 60-working day rollover rule as a means to obtain their retirement money if needed for a brief time.
